About Fannan
The surname Fannan is of Irish origin and is derived from the Gaelic name Ó Fannáin, meaning "descendant of Fannán." Fannán is a personal name derived from the word "fann," which means "weak" or "feeble." The surname Fannan is relatively rare and is primarily found in County Limerick, Ireland.
